A grape variety that is indigenous to the Alto Adige, this Schiava comes from the oldest Kurtatsch vineyards, growing between 300 and 400 metres above sea-level. These old vines produce naturally low yields of high quality grapes. As is typical of this grape, this 2020 is very pretty, glisteningly pale ruby. Aromas are incredibly enticing, fragrant and pure, with notes of strawberries and red cherries. This is a lively, light of touch wine with a freshness and clarity that speak of Alto Adige`s mountain air. It has vibrancy, excellent concentration and a silky, elegant finish. This will appeal greatly to lovers of Pinot Noir and fresh, lively styles of red wine.
